Are you a self-motivated individual with NHS quality assurance experience? Are you looking for an exciting opportunity to make a real difference in a support role?

Due to growth, we are looking for an experienced clinical quality support officer to join the clinical quality team. The team of over 30 staff offers clinical quality assurance services to a wide array of clients across the health sector, including ICB and Place Commissioners as well as provider collaboratives with NECS staff based across North East England. The Clinical Quality Support Officer provides a key supporting role to the Clinical Quality Managers contributing their knowledge and skills in respect of the national and ICS/ICB level clinical quality agenda as well as providing senior support to the clinical quality administrators.
